Aussie keeper into Europa League QFs

Mat Ryan's Genk have progressed to the last eight of the Europa League following a 1-1 draw with Gent overnight.

In the second leg of their Round of 16 tie, Genk went in with a commanding 5-2 lead from the first tie. 

In the end, there would be no miracle comeback at the Genk Arena as Albert Stuivenberg's men eased past their opponents 6-3 on aggregate. 

Genk are through to a UEFA club competition quarter-final for the first time in club history.

The draw for the last eight will be made later today (Friday). 

Ryan is due to link up with the Caltex Socceroos in the coming days ahead of two massive World Cup qualifiers in Tehran and Sydney.
